Where each one falls short

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.

MuleSoft

  • Listed on UK G-Cloud at £6.39 per user per month for the Salesforce MuleSoft Anypoint Platform, via reseller Skyflo Digital Ltd

Talend

  • Pricing page for all four editions (Starter, Standard, Premium, Enterprise) shows Contact Us or Contact Sales instead of any dollar figures
  • Billed by usage capacity combining data volume moved, number of job executions and execution duration rather than a simple per seat rate
